What is OWASP GoatDroid?

OWASP GoatDroid is an open-source project developed by the Open Web Application Security Project (OWASP). It is designed as a training platform for developers and security professionals to learn about Android application security. GoatDroid provides a simulated environment where users can explore various vulnerabilities commonly found in Android applications. By engaging with GoatDroid, users can gain hands-on experience in identifying and mitigating these vulnerabilities.

Common Android Vulnerabilities Explored in GoatDroid

OWASP GoatDroid covers a range of vulnerabilities that are critical for anyone involved in Android development or security. Some of the most common vulnerabilities include:

  • Insecure Data Storage: Many applications store sensitive data insecurely, making it vulnerable to unauthorized access. GoatDroid teaches users how to identify and mitigate these risks.

  • Insecure Communication: Applications often fail to implement secure communication protocols, exposing data to interception. Users learn how to secure data in transit effectively.

  • Improper Authentication: Weak authentication mechanisms can lead to unauthorized access. GoatDroid provides scenarios where users can practice implementing robust authentication methods.

  • Code Injection: This vulnerability allows attackers to execute arbitrary code within an application. GoatDroid helps users understand how to prevent such attacks.

  • Insecure WebView Implementation: WebViews can introduce significant security risks if not implemented correctly. Users learn best practices for using WebViews securely.
